Care, Durability, and Longevity
To maximize lifespan, wash towels before first use and follow care labels. Use warm or cold water, avoid chlorine bleach that can weaken fibers, and tumble dry on low. Removing towels promptly from the dryer minimizes wrinkles and helps preserve shape. Regular rotation in households prevents uneven wear and helps maintain absorbency and softness. With proper care, high-quality flour sack towels retain their starched-like feel and can remain lint-free for many washing cycles, making them a long-term kitchen staple.
Size, Absorbency, and Use Cases
Choose a size that fits your space and tasks. Large 28×28 towels cover more surface area for drying large pots or wiping down countertops, while 24×24 towels fit compact sinks and smaller drying tasks. Consider how you plan to use towels—if you embroidery or craft, a stable, tightly woven towel can provide a reliable base. For glassware and mirror cleaning, lint-free performance is essential. A mix of sizes in a household can accommodate diverse chores without compromising efficiency.
